青贮玉米秸与4种羊常用粗饲料间的组合效应研究  被引量:5

Study on the Combined Effect of Corn Stalk with Roughages

在线阅读下载全文

作  者:袁翠林[1] 王利华[1] 于子洋[1] 朱亚骏[1] 林英庭[1] 

机构地区:[1]青岛农业大学动物科技学院,山东青岛266109

出  处:《中国畜牧杂志》2014年第15期50-53,共4页Chinese Journal of Animal Science

基  金:山东省现代农业产业技术体系羊产业创新团队(SATS-201226-3)

摘  要:本试验将青贮玉米秸分别与豆秸、豆渣、地瓜秧和花生蔓以0:100、20:80、40:60、60:40、80:20、100:0比例进行组合,以探讨青贮玉米秸与四种羊常用粗饲料间的组合效应。试验采用体外瘤胃发酵技术,以产气量、pH、氨态氮浓度作为监测指标。结果表明:各粗饲料组合、比例对产气量和氨态氮(NH_3-N)有显著影响(P<0.05),且二者存在互作;粗饲料的组合对反应体系pH有显著影响(P<0.05),但不同比例间无显著差异(P>0.05)。在本试验条件下,青贮玉米秸与花生蔓组合、各粗饲料比例为40:60可获得最大NH_3-N。青贮玉米秸-豆秸按80:20组合产气量最多;青贮玉米秸-豆渣、青贮玉米秸-地瓜秧组合时,豆渣、地瓜秧达到100时产气量最高;青贮玉米秸-花生蔓按40:60组合时产气量最高。The experiment was conducted to investigate the combined effects of different rations of corn stalk silage (CS) to soybean stalk (SS), sweet potato residues (SR), soybeanpulp (SP), and peanut residues (PS) on fermentation in vitro, respectively. CS and SS, CS and SR, CS and SP, and CS and PR weremixed in rations of 0:100, 20:80, 40:60, 60:40, 80:20, 100:0 with 3 replicates, respectively. The combined effects of CS and the other roughages were assessed by the in vitro rumen fermentation technology to monitor gas production (GP), pH value, ammonia nitrogen (NH3-N). The results showed that there were significant differences for gas production and NH3-N (P〈0.05)between different combinations. There were not significant differences for pH value (P〉0.05)between different combinations. It was concluded that the combination of CS with SS, SR, SP and PR in ration of 80:20, 0:100, 0:100, 40:60 had the greatest gas production, respectively.
